I’ve encountered (quite by accident) an interesting behavior in BIND with wildcard domains:
The relevant configuration is a zone; e.g. bar.com, with what I’ll call a “second level” wildcard host, e.g. *.foo.bar.com A 10.10.10.5 in that zone. (as opposed to what might be considered the more usual wildcard host record of *.bar.com).
buz.foo.bar.com returns A 10.10.10.5 as expected.
However, a query for foo.bar.com returns NOERR with zero results, when I would expect a NXDOMAIN.
Anyone know if the NOERR with zero results is the expected / correct behavior?
